Auctionbytes eBay Limits Sellers from Listing Books in Two CategoriesAuctionbytesThe reason, according to eBay spokesperson Johnna Hoff, has to do with eBay's catalog. "For items listed in categories where listing with the catalog is mandatory, you may only list your item in a single category," Hoff said. More: continued here

LA city offices closed for Cesar Chavez DayLos Angeles TimesFederal offices, including the US Post Office, also will remain open. In 2000, state legislators and former Gov. Gray Davis established March 31 as Cesar Chavez Day, the first state holiday in the country to honor a Latino or organized labor …
